
Aerobic exercise can cause your body temperature rises as your metabolism increases to provide energy. It is important for pregnant women to exercise, but not to the point where your body temperature increase. The constant movement of both arms and legs, typical of most aerobic programs, provides training that can reach high levels of intensity. Therefore, it is important to participate in an aerobics program that the instructor knows the special needs of pregnancy and exercise can be adjusted accordingly. Aerobics are recommended low-or no impact, swimming or biking.
Benefits of walking
A good activity that can begin during pregnancy is a walking program, three to five days a week. Walking is an inexpensive way to exercise, since the only requirements are a pair of shoes and comfortable clothes. It is also an activity that can be integrated immediately to your daily itinerary. During pregnancy you can improve your aerobic fitness by walking on a floor without levels at a comfortable pace. However, it may be necessary to use modified forms of walking to get significant benefits. Increasing walking speed, up and down hills, carrying weights and walking are exercises that can raise the heart rate to levels that will improve your aerobic fitness.
